Internal Memo — Board

The regional sales review for the Ostermere and Calden territories is complete. Ostermere exceeded target by 6%, driven by the Fenwright account renewals. Calden fell short, largely due to delayed onboarding of the Britlow product line. Management has reassigned two senior reps and revised the Calden forecast downward. Further detail on how these results shape our forward plans appears in the note below.

management briefing: Jorixax Holdings is in early talks to buy Casixax Holdings for about $420.3 million. The Fenmir launch date is October 27, and nothing goes to the press before then. Legal wants the Keloxek Foods term sheet redrafted before April 16.

Handover: password reset revamp on Quillgate is live behind a flag. Tokens now expire in 15 minutes, single-use. Old emails still route through the legacy sender until Friday. If users report dead links, check flag state first, then token age. Marla owns rollback. The current service configuration values are listed below.

config for bagep-kageg:
ULADOR_LOG_LEVEL=warn
ULADOR_METRICS_HOST=metrics.ulador.tolvaqcorp.corp
ULADOR_POOL_SIZE=32

## Runbook: Replica Lag Alarm Response

If the Driftwell read-replica lag alarm fires, first check whether a bulk import is running — that's usually it. If lag exceeds 10 minutes, fail reads over to the primary via the toggle deploy. That toggle bundle must be signed; sign it with the key below:

rollout seal: bky4_x7Gc

Handover note — Dispatch desk, evening shift

Hey Tomas, quick rundown before I head off. The stage props for the Lanternfall touring show (three road cases, the big one marked "moon rig — fragile") are staged by dock door 2. Crew from Pyrelight Productions confirmed they want everything moving first thing, and Harrowgate Haulage is booked for 7:30. Paperwork's clipped to the middle case. One important thing: when the driver checks in, you need to pass along the hand-over instruction written just below.

drop instructions, yafog-yawip: the quenmir olidor courier leaves the julox tamion keliel ledger at gate 5283 under passcode 336825